S1E8: What's for Dinner? (with John Turturro)

Jan 15, 2025
Join John Turturro, the Emmy-winning actor known for his iconic roles, as he chats about his dynamic working relationship with Christopher Walken and his friendship with Zach Cherry. Turturro reveals a near-miss with a legendary filmmaker, adding spice to the conversation. The trio dives into character development, exploring how Irving's identity is shaped through art and music. They also discuss the emotional struggles within the workplace and the quirky humor that brings the cast together.

Irving's Hidden Depths

The episode offers a compelling glimpse into Irving's life beyond Lumen, unveiling a brilliant and creative persona. His early morning routine, highlighted by painting while rocking out to Motorhead’s 'Ace of Spades', showcases his artistic side, illustrating a stark contrast to his constrained work life. John's dedication to this duality is evident, as he practices the painting process to authentically capture the character’s hidden talents. This revelation not only deepens Irving's character but also resonates with viewers, as they witness the juxtaposition of his mundane job and vibrant out-of-work identity.
